In a democratic society, the idea of a former president facing imprisonment might seem like a plot from a political thriller. However, it's a scenario that raises intriguing questions about the logistics involved, particularly concerning the security measures provided by the Secret Service. Let's delve into this hypothetical scenario and explore the intricate details.

Firstly, the notion of a president going to prison is unprecedented in modern American history. However, it's essential to understand that no individual, regardless of their position or power, is above the law. If a former president were to be convicted of a crime serious enough to warrant imprisonment, it would undoubtedly trigger a series of complex logistical challenges.

One of the primary considerations would be the security arrangements for the former president during their incarceration. Despite their status change, former presidents are entitled to Secret Service protection for the rest of their lives, as per the Former Presidents Act of 1958. This protection extends to various aspects of their lives, including residential security, travel, and public appearances. However, when it comes to incarceration, the dynamics change significantly.

In the event of a former president being incarcerated, the Secret Service would have to collaborate closely with the relevant law enforcement agencies and correctional facilities to ensure the safety and security of the individual. While the Secret Service's mandate primarily revolves around protecting current and former presidents, their role in a prison setting would be limited compared to their traditional duties.

The logistical challenges would be multifaceted. Firstly, the correctional facility would need to accommodate the former president's security detail, which might involve designating a separate area for them within the prison premises. This area would need to meet strict security standards while also ensuring that it does not compromise the overall security of the facility.

Furthermore, the Secret Service agents tasked with protecting the former president would require specialized training to navigate the intricacies of a prison environment. They would need to adapt their tactics and protocols to ensure the safety of their charge while adhering to the rules and regulations of the correctional facility.

Another crucial aspect to consider is the potential security risks posed by other inmates. A former president's presence in a prison could attract significant attention, both from the media and other inmates. This heightened visibility could make the individual a target for threats or attacks, necessitating enhanced security measures.

Moreover, maintaining the former president's privacy and dignity would be paramount throughout the incarceration process. While their status may have changed, they are still entitled to a certain level of respect and dignity, which the Secret Service would need to uphold while fulfilling their security obligations.

In addition to the physical security arrangements, there would also be logistical considerations regarding the former president's communication with the outside world. While incarcerated, they would have limited access to phones and other forms of communication, which could impact their ability to stay informed and engaged with ongoing developments.

Overall, the logistics of a former president going to prison and the accompanying Secret Service security accommodations would be unprecedented and complex. It would require close coordination between multiple stakeholders, including law enforcement agencies, correctional facilities, and the Secret Service, to ensure the safety and security of all involved parties while upholding the principles of justice and the rule of law.
